Kaḍitale (ಕಡಿತಲೆ):—

1) [noun] a weapon consisting of long blades on both the sides, fixed in a hilt with a guard for the hand, used for cutting or thrusting; a double-edged sword.

2) [noun] a broad piece of defensive armour usu. made of metal, and used to protect the body in fighting; a shield.

--- OR ---

Kaḍitale (ಕಡಿತಲೆ):—[noun] a head cut off from the rest of the body.
